3/16 equals -5/4+ G solve for G

Answers

Answer:

G = 23/16  OR  G = 1.4375

Step-by-step explanation:

3/16 = -5/4 + G

Get the constants on one side. Add 5/4 on both sides.

3/16 + 5/4 = G

To add fractions, find the common denominator. The smallest denominator between these two fractions is 16.

3/16 stays the same since it already has the denominator of 16. To turn the denominator (4) in 5/4 into 16, multiply it by 4. Whatever you do to the denominator, you must do to the numerator.

5 x 4 = 20

The second fraction is now 20/16

3/16 + 20/16 = 23/16

G = 23/16

The answer is : 23/16

Problem 1:

{(-2, 1), (-2, 3), (0, -3), (1, 4), (3, 1)}

This relation is not a function because there are two y-values, 1 and 3, related to one x-value, -2.

Thus, for a relation to be a function, every x-value must be related to exactly 1 y-value.

Problem 2:

{(0, 2), (3, 4), (-3, -2), (2, 4)}

In this relation, each x-value (domain) has exactly one y-value (range) that it is related to. Therefore, this is a function.
